What’s the difference between a Pancake and a Waffle?

The batters for both Pancakes and Waffles are very similar but the difference is the waffles have more fat and sometimes more sugar. Pancakes and Waffles also look very different. While Pancakes are soft and floppy, Waffles have a crispy outside and a soft and chewy inside. Another difference is how they are cooked. Pancakes are cooked on a hot surface like a pan or griddle. Waffles are made with a waffle maker.

1. Choosing The Right Ingredients

It doesn’t matter if you have a homemade pancake/waffle mix or a store-bought mix, make sure it is not past date. The pancake and waffle mixes contain baking powder or baking soda. Those two ingredients in the mix will make them fluffy. After the expiration date passes, those two ingredients could decrease in quality, and the pancakes and waffles will become denser.

2. Preheating Your Cooking Surface

Your pan, griddle, or waffle maker needs to be hot before adding the batter. Preheating it will make sure your pancake or waffle is cooked properly. The ideal temperature for the cooking surface should be 375 degrees or a medium heat setting. Waffle makers normally cook at 375 degrees as well.

3. Perfecting The Batter Consistency

The perfect pancake batter will still have lumps! You will want to ensure there are no flour streaks but you don’t want the gluten to overdevelop, which will happen if it is over stirred. You can still use the batter if it is stirred too much though! The pancakes will be more chewy and dense. When making waffle batter, you will need to make sure all of the lumps are taken care of! It should be thinner than pancake batter.

5. Measuring Batter Accurately

The best way to measure pancake batter is using a 1/4 measuring cup. This will give you a pancake that is about 4 inches across. You can make the pancakes bigger but remember the batter will go faster so it will make fewer pancakes and it might be difficult to flip.

For waffles, you will want to follow the instructions for your waffle maker. For your standard waffle maker, 3/4 cup or until it fills the lower grid.

6. Knowing When To Flip

Keep an eye on the air pockets when you are cooking the pancakes. They will tell you when to flip! You will first see bubbles form and when they pop, if the air pockets don’t fill back up, your pancake is about to be done! The sides of the pancake will also start to form. It will take about 2 minutes (1 minute for each side) to cook.

9. Common Mistakes To Avoid

Here are three common mistakes that can happen when you are making pancakes and how to avoid them.

  1. Pancakes sticking to the pan:You might need to reapply oil or cooking spray depending on how many pancakes or waffles you make. I will spray my griddle, pan, or waffle maker again after 5 to 6 of them. This will make sure they won’t stick.
  2. Flipping too early or too much: You should only be flipping the pancake when the air pockets form and they stay open. You should also only be flipping the pancake one time.
  3. Flattening your pancakes: When you are cooking your pancakes, make sure you don’t push down on them. As long as you are not cooking on low heat, the pancakes will cook throughout without you pushing them down.
